Silverfish and moisture pest containment focuses on breaking the ecological drivers of indoor infestations rather than coating baseboards in volatile neurotoxins. Silverfish require an ambient relative humidity above 75% to sustain reproduction and feed primarily on polysaccharides, such as wallpaper paste, book bindings, and cellulose insulation. In older Lucas County framing, particularly across the historic properties of the Old West End and Five Points, unconditioned cellars create capillary moisture movement through stone foundations. This moisture creates an ideal harborage zone directly beneath living spaces. Containment pairs inorganic amorphous silica gel or borate powders with physical structural exclusion, preventing pests from migrating upwards into pantries and clothing storage areas.
Waterfront micro-climates along the Maumee River and Lake Erie basin in Point Place or the Warehouse District present sustained high baseline humidity that simple chemical spraying fails to resolve. Traditional synthetic pyrethroid perimeter sprays degrade rapidly in damp conditions, often failing within 21 to 30 days while leaving chemical residues near family living areas. Physical containment manages this vulnerability by sealing plumbing escutcheon penetrations beneath sinks, applying elastomeric sealant to floor-to-wall foundation interfaces, and treating wall voids with long-lasting mineral desiccants that remain active as long as they stay dry.
For suburban split-level and slab-on-grade architecture in West Toledo, Beverly, and adjacent Ottawa Hills, moisture containment resolves perimeter intrusions around ground-level vents, crawl spaces, and utility conduit entries. The trade-off between standard broad-spectrum extermination and physical moisture containment rests on durability: chemical-only sprays yield a rapid initial knockdown but leave structural entry points and feeding attractants intact, requiring indefinite re-application cycles. Comprehensive moisture containment requires correcting underlying dampness and physical harborages, delivering structural protection that safeguards indoor air quality and keeps family living spaces free from ongoing pesticide exposure.
